Listed by BD RealtySet in one of Brisbane's most sought-after bayside suburbs, this beautifully presented residence offers the ideal combination of space, style and family functionality. Located in leafy Wynnum West, just 20 minutes from the CBD, the home enjoys proximity to top-performing schools, three train stations, and a huge selection of shopping and dining across over 59 local specialty stores. Nature lovers and active families will love the bay breezes, wide green streets, and easy access to the Wynnum Golf Club, Esplanade and the ever-popular Whale Park and Wading Pool.
Upstairs, polished timber floors and soft natural light create a warm and inviting feel throughout the main living zone. The spacious lounge is fitted with both ceiling fan and split-system air conditioning for year-round comfort, flowing seamlessly onto a charming timber-decked balcony - the perfect spot for morning coffees or twilight drinks overlooking the front garden.
The stylish kitchen pairs practicality with charm,showcasing crisp white cabinetry, a Chef electric cooktop and oven, marble-look benchtops, and an integrated dining nook with clever built-in shelving and a beautiful leafy outlook.
The upstairs master includes plush carpet, air conditioning, a ceiling fan, and large sunlit windows that bathe the room in natural light. Two additional queen-sized bedrooms are similarly well-appointed - one also includes a split-system AC. All three are serviced by a tastefully renovated bathroom with a rain shower, feature niche, sleek vanity, mirrored wall cabinet, and a separate toilet.
Downstairs offers a fully self-contained retreat - whilst not legal height, it is not to be underestimated. Featuring a fourth king-sized room currently utilised as a bedroom (the advertised fourth bedroom) featuring walk-in wardrobe, tiled living and dining zones with split-system air conditioning, a kitchenette, and a separate workshop. It's the ultimate in versatility, ideal for multigenerational living, guests.
Set on a fully fenced 607m² allotment, designed for lifestyle and practicality. A generous covered patio and BBQ area offer the ultimate in outdoor entertaining, while the expansive backyard offers plenty of room for kids, pets, or a future pool (STCA). Tradespeople and hobbyists will appreciate the 6x6m shed for tools, side access for trailers or boats, as well as workshop area, single carport. A greenhouse, and separate pavilion adds even more value to this outdoor haven. The downstairs laundry is neatly tucked away in a dedicated utility room, rounding out this home's liveability.
